The Early Life and Rise of a Football Prodigy
Alright, let's rewind the clock and head back to the heart of Brazil. Edson Arantes do Nascimento, or as the world would come to know him, Pele, was born in Três Corações, Minas Gerais. It was 1940, and the world was a very different place. Pele's upbringing wasn't easy; his family faced financial struggles. Despite these hardships, young Edson found solace and passion in football. Seriously, it's like he was born to play! He started honing his skills on the streets, using anything he could find as a ball. This raw, street-smart approach to the game would later become a defining characteristic of his playing style. Football wasn't just a game for Pele; it was a way of life, a form of expression, and a path to a better future. The passion he had was visible even then.
His talent was undeniable from a young age. Pele's father, a footballer himself, recognized his son's potential and provided early guidance. The young Pele quickly rose through the ranks, showcasing extraordinary skills that set him apart from his peers. He had an innate ability to dribble, score, and see plays develop before they even happened. It was almost magical, the way he moved on the field. This early training and the sheer joy of playing propelled him forward. By the time he was a teenager, he was already attracting attention from professional clubs. The world was beginning to take notice of this young Brazilian prodigy. He wasn't just good; he was exceptional, and everyone knew it. The Santos Era: A Period of Unprecedented Success
Okay, buckle up, because this is where things get really interesting! Pele's professional career began in 1956 with Santos FC, a club based in the port city of Santos, Brazil. Little did anyone know, this would be the start of a golden era for both Pele and the club. At just 16 years old, he made his debut and quickly became a key player. He started scoring goals, lots of them, and leading the team to victory after victory. He became a legend in the making. The combination of Pele's skill and the club's growing ambition proved to be a recipe for success. They won numerous state championships, showcasing their dominance in Brazilian football.
But it wasn't just about domestic success; Pele and Santos conquered the international stage. They won the Copa Libertadores, the South American equivalent of the Champions League, not once but twice! Then came the Intercontinental Cup, where they faced off against the best teams in Europe. And guess what? They won that too! These victories propelled Pele and Santos to global fame. The world began to recognize Pele as not just a talented player, but as a football superstar. His name was on everyone's lips, and his performances were watched by millions. He became a symbol of Brazilian football, representing the flair, skill, and joy that the sport embodied. The Santos era wasn't just about trophies; it was about the way Pele played the game. His style was captivating, filled with breathtaking dribbles, acrobatic goals, and an unparalleled understanding of the game. He was a showman, entertaining fans and inspiring awe with every match. Pele and the Brazilian National Team: World Cup Glory
Now, let's talk about the biggest stage of all: the World Cup. Pele's impact on the Brazilian national team was nothing short of extraordinary. He first appeared in the World Cup in 1958, at the tender age of 17. Can you imagine the pressure? But Pele didn't just participate; he dominated. He scored crucial goals, including a hat-trick in the semi-final and two goals in the final, helping Brazil win their first World Cup title. This victory was a defining moment for Brazilian football and for Pele. He instantly became a national hero, a symbol of hope and pride for the country.
He would go on to win two more World Cups with Brazil: in 1962 and 1970. In 1962, though injured early in the tournament, Brazil still won, showcasing the team's strength. In 1970, Pele led a team often considered the greatest ever to grace the World Cup. The way Brazil played was a sight to behold, a fusion of skill, creativity, and teamwork that left opponents and fans in awe. Pele's performance in this tournament was a masterclass. He scored goals, set up plays, and inspired his teammates with his leadership and skill. He led the team to the trophy. The 1970 World Cup victory was a pinnacle of Pele's career and a moment of national celebration in Brazil. These World Cup victories cemented Pele's status as a legend, a player who not only achieved individual brilliance but also led his team to unprecedented success on the world stage. The Global Icon: Beyond the Pitch
Alright, let's talk about Pele the global icon. He wasn't just a footballer; he was a cultural phenomenon. His fame transcended the sport, making him one of the most recognizable figures in the world. He became a global ambassador for football and for Brazil, using his platform to promote peace, understanding, and social causes. This is pretty awesome, right? He traveled the world, meeting heads of state, celebrities, and fans from all walks of life. His charisma and genuine warmth made him a beloved figure everywhere he went.
After his playing career, Pele continued to be involved in football and humanitarian efforts. He served as a UN ambassador and used his influence to advocate for children's rights, education, and environmental causes. He was also involved in various business ventures and remained a prominent figure in the media. His legacy extends far beyond his achievements on the field.
